Web10 apr. 2024 · A gutter apron is a metal structure that you place on the edges of your roof. This helps water flow down the slanted surface and into the gutter system. Doing so reduces the chances of serious water damage. Typically, the aprons have an L-shaped cross-section and consist of aluminum or steel. WebIncorrect installation! The gutters should be hung and tucked under the drip edge. The water runs off shingles, drips off drip edge and runs into gutter. This installation compromises the drip edge and it’s instead purpose. It will leak behind the gutter and cause fascia and decking to become rotted Web28 nov. 2024 · 2.
